網絡如何加密

網絡加密是保護數據傳輸安全的重要手段,以下是幾種常見的網絡加密方法:1. 對稱加密: 定義:使用相同的密鑰進行加密和解密。 示例:AES(高級加密標準)、DES(數據加...
網絡加密是保護數據傳輸安全的重要手段,以下是幾種常見的網絡加密方法:
1. 對稱加密:
定義:使用相同的密鑰進行加密和解密。
示例:AES(高級加密標準)、DES(數據加密標準)。
優點:速度快,適用于大量數據的加密。
缺點:密鑰管理復雜,密鑰分發困難。
2. 非對稱加密:
定義:使用一對密鑰,一個用于加密,一個用于解密。
示例:RSA、ECC(橢圓曲線加密)。
優點:密鑰分發簡單,適合在網絡上傳輸密鑰。
缺點:計算量大,速度慢。
3. 哈希函數:
定義:將任意長度的數據轉換成固定長度的數據(指紋)。
示例:MD5、SHA-1、SHA-256。
優點:速度快,不易逆向。
缺點:可能存在碰撞問題。
4. 數字簽名:
定義:結合了非對稱加密和哈希函數。
示例:RSA簽名、ECDSA簽名。
優點:可以驗證數據的完整性和發送者的身份。
缺點:計算量大。
5. VPN(虛擬私人網絡):
定義:通過加密技術,將數據在網絡中傳輸。
優點:可以保護數據在公共網絡中的傳輸安全。
缺點:速度可能受到影響。
6. SSL/TLS(安全套接層/傳輸層安全):
定義:在互聯網上提供數據加密、完整性驗證和身份驗證。
示例:HTTPS、SMTPS、IMAPS。
優點:廣泛使用,適用于多種網絡應用。
缺點:配置和管理較為復雜。
在具體應用中,可以根據需要選擇合適的加密方法。例如,對于個人隱私保護,可以使用對稱加密和非對稱加密相結合的方式;對于網絡通信,可以使用SSL/TLS等技術來保證數據傳輸的安全性。
本文鏈接:http://www.resource-tj.com/bian/439148.html
上一篇:三國13如何快速攻城